
Metro Manila (CNN Philippines) — Jackson Vroman, former import of Barangay Ginebra, was found dead in a pool at his home Monday (June 29), according to a report by The Salt Lake Tribune.
Earlier reports said Vroman died in a car accident, but Dan Bilzerian, a friend of Vroman’s, went on social media saying that the 34-year-old cager hit his head and drowned in his pool.

The Los Angeles County Examiner-Coroner’s office said that no report is available yet but is expected upon the completion of the autopsy after a few days.
Vroman suited up for Barangay Ginebra in the 2012 Commissioner’s Cup, averaging 16.6 points, 12.0 rebounds and 2.4 blocks in 11 games.
Prior to playing for the Gin Kings, he had stints in the National Basketball Association with the Phoenix Suns (2004-2005) and the New Orleans Hornets (2005-2006). He also played with a few clubs overseas.
In 2009 he was naturalized as a Lebanese citizen to play for the national basketball team of Lebanon.
